Roofing evaluation services involve a comprehensive assessment of a property's roof to identify existing issues and determine its overall condition. These evaluations typically include a visual inspection of the roof surface, flashing, gutters, and other key components, often complemented by non-invasive testing methods. The goal is to detect problems such as leaks, damaged shingles, deterioration, or structural concerns that could compromise the roof's integrity. By thoroughly examining the roof, service providers can offer insights into its current state and recommend necessary repairs or maintenance to prevent further damage.
This service plays a vital role in addressing common roofing problems that can lead to costly repairs if left unattended. For instance, early identification of leaks, cracked or missing shingles, or signs of wear can help property owners avoid more extensive damage to the underlying structure. Roofing evaluations also assist in assessing the safety and stability of the roof, especially after severe weather events or over time as materials age. Detecting issues early supports proactive maintenance strategies, potentially extending the lifespan of the roof and improving overall property protection.

The overview below groups typical Roofing Evaluation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Alpine,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Costs - Roofing evaluation services typically range from $150 to $400 for a comprehensive inspection. Prices vary depending on the property size and inspection complexity, with larger homes in Alpine, NJ, often costing toward the higher end.
Assessment Fees - Detailed roof assessments usually cost between $200 and $600. These fees may depend on roof height, pitch, and accessibility, with more complex roofs incurring higher charges.
Evaluation Service Rates - The cost for roofing evaluation services can range from $100 to $500 per assessment. Some providers may include additional diagnostics or reports at extra cost.
Consultation Expenses - Consulting on roof condition and potential repairs generally costs between $150 and $350. Prices are influenced by the scope of evaluation and local market rates in the Alpine area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ing evaluation? A roofing evaluation is an assessment performed by a professional to determine the condition of a roof and identify potential issues or areas needing repair.
How often should I have my roof evaluated? It is recommended to have a roof evaluated regularly, especially after severe weather events or if the roof is approaching the end of its typical lifespan.
What are common signs indicating I need a roof evaluation? Signs include missing or damaged shingles, leaks, water stains on ceilings, or visible wear and deterioration on the roof surface.
What does a roofing evaluation typically include? The process usually involves inspecting the roof’s surface, checking for damage, assessing flashing and gutters, and identifying any underlying issues.
How can a roofing evaluation benefit my property? A professional evaluation can help detect problems early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the life of the roof.
